Haiti - Economy : The Pink Credit becomes the Solidarity Credit

Yanick Mézile, Minister for the Status of Women and Women's Rights, announced that the credit program for women, originally named "Credit Rose" (Kredi Wòz) (Pink Credit) [who has experienced starting difficulties], will no be named "Crédit solidaire" (Solidarity Credit).

This pilot program, that will be managed by the Fund of Economic and Social Assistance (FAES) will be launched in November in 31 municipalities. Eligible women will be selected by group of five, before spreading gradually over time.

The beneficiaries will have access to a credit between 15,000 and 30,000 gourdes. "We'll start with the rural women," indicated the minister, who stressed the important role of women in agricultural production and processing, adding that within 6 months, a fund to support rural women will be established.

At the local level, the program monitoring will be carried out by women, which will help the beneficiaries to manage their credit. Training sessions on the principles of credit are also planned as part of the pilot program.
